Cox Castle is pleased to announce that nine attorneys from our Firm have been selected to the 2023 Northern California Super Lawyers list. These prestigious honors include the top five percent of the lawyers practicing in Northern California. The selected attorneys include:

  • Scott Birkey, Land Use/Zoning
  • Margo Bradish***, Land Use/Zoning 
  • Robert Doty, Environmental Litigation
  • Amy Foo*-***, Land Use/Zoning
  • Arielle Harris, Land Use/Zoning
  • Robert Hull*, Land Use/Zoning
  • Anne Mudge***, Land Use/Zoning 
  • Andrew Sabey, Environmental Litigation
  • Mike Zischke**, Land Use/Zoning

Super Lawyers, part of Thomson Reuters, is a highly competitive rating service of outstanding lawyers from more than 70 practice areas who have attained a high degree of peer recognition and professional achievement. The annual selections are based on a statewide survey of lawyers, an independent research evaluation of candidates and peer reviews by practice area. The result is a credible and comprehensive listing of exceptional attorneys. The Super Lawyers lists are published nationwide in Super Lawyers Magazines and newspapers across the country.
